Description
Special Operation Forces Faction mod [SFF] that adds the Malden Defence Forces to Arma.

Historical Info-

Malden is a small island with a relatively small population, and the most important event to happen since the Napoleonic Wars in the early 1800's was it's involvement in the War of 1985, where the island was invaded by Soviet forces against a small United States Army garrison. In the aftermath of the conflict itself the Malden government decided to allocate increasing government funding for their own military force, the Malden Defence Forces, which were established in 1987, with stocks of ex-European arms arriving and being adopted by the military.

The Faction-

The Malden Armed Forces are primarily Infantry based, and are decently equipped with primarily European weapons and equipment, with the tan AUG A2 with Docktor optic being standard issue.

The standard uniform of the MDF is an arid 6 Colour 'Choc Chip' camo pattern, with CIRAS body armour and MICH helmets used for the majority of soldiers. Small numbers of AUG A1's and AUG 9mm PDW's are used in reserve and non-combat roles such as engineers, crewmen, pilots and assistants, as the older rifles and optics are still more effective than a sidearm.

The primary support weapons are the AUG HBAR (Heavy Barrel Automatic Rifle), which is used on the fireteam level as a light automatic rifle, and the SIG DMR, which is the standard Marksman rifle. Minimi machineguns are used as a squad and support level weapon, similar to the US Marines.
Standard sidearms are old 1980's German P226's and P228's, with more modern versions used by commandos and higher-ranking units.

Specialist Elements-

The Malden 2nd Commando Regiment is the pride of the small Malden military, and they have distinctive British DPM uniforms and berets. Because of their higher budget compared to the standard armed forces, some of which are still using firearms from 1980's and 1990's, the Commandos have the more modern AUG-A3's, as well as access to more magnified optics and accessories such as larger stocks of night vision, IR lasers and body armour.
In the event of a second war on Malden, the 2nd Commandos (as the 1st Commandos are purely a reserve and training unit) would be mobilised and used for raiding and attacks on enemy forces, based out of small mountain compounds and cave complexes around the centre of Malden.

Supports-

Due to the MDF being a smaller military, their support assets are focused around rapid, air-mobile redeployment of their forces in order to counter an attacking invader force as rapidly as possible before they establish a major beachhead on the island.

They rely on fast-moving lighter vehicles like Light Strike Vehicles, Wiesel's with a range of armaments, with it filling roles as air-defence and recon as well as a fighting vehicle. Motorised trucks or APC's are their primary method of moving larger numbers of infantry forces, with the Commandos being more likely to be airborne.

The Malden Defence Forces have little in the way of heavy assets, having no main battle tanks and instead make use of air power from JAS 39 Gripens, Chinooks and AW-159 armed helicopters.

Faction has full Editor, Zeus, Task Force Radio and ALiVE support (faction name MDF ) Also supports ACE3 Medical system.
